At-Home Styling Routines
Morning Regimen
Perry’s typical morning routine prioritizes heat protection and separation. She applies a silicone-free heat protectant, air-dries sections, then uses a medium-barreled iron at moderate temperature for soft bends. A light mist of flexible hold hairspray sets the shape without stiffness.
Product Kit Essentials
- Silicone-free heat protectant spray
- Medium-barreled ceramic curling iron
- Flexible hold hairspray
- Scalp-friendly shampoo and lightweight conditioner
- Weekly protein or moisture mask
Salon Maintenance and Color Care
Trimming Schedule
To preserve length while removing split ends, Perry schedules trims every 10–12 weeks. This interval supports shape integrity and minimizes breakage, aligning with long-hair goals.
Color Protection Strategy
Color-safe formulas with UV filters and antioxidants help maintain vibrancy between appointments. Cold-water rinses and low-heat drying reduce fade, supporting both tone longevity and strand integrity.
